Olmsted Outerwear is a brand that prioritizes sustainability and environmental consciousness in the fashion industry. With a focus on using eco-friendly materials and manufacturing practices, they aim to reduce their carbon footprint and minimize textile waste. Their efforts have earned them a ‘good’ environment rating.

Eco-Friendly Materials

Olmsted Outerwear is committed to using a medium proportion of eco-friendly materials in their products. They prioritize the use of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S) cotton, which ensures that their cotton is grown without the use of harmful chemicals or genetically modified organisms. This not only benefits the environment but also promotes the health and well-being of the farmers who grow the cotton.

Local Manufacturing

In an effort to reduce their carbon footprint, Olmsted Outerwear manufactures their products locally. By producing their garments close to their customers, they are able to minimize the emissions associated with transportation and support local economies. Local manufacturing also allows for better quality control and more efficient communication between the brand and their production partners.

Made to Order

Olmsted Outerwear takes a proactive approach to minimizing textile waste by producing their products on a made-to-order basis. This means that they only produce garments when they are ordered by customers, reducing the risk of overproduction and excess inventory. By embracing this approach, they are able to avoid the environmental impact of unnecessary textile waste and contribute to a more sustainable fashion industry.

Fair Labour Practices

Olmsted Outerwear’s labour rating is ‘it’s a start’, suggesting that there is room for improvement in this area. While their final stage of production takes place in Canada, a country known for low risk of labour abuse, there is no evidence that the brand ensures payment of a living wage in its supply chain. However, they do visit their suppliers regularly and conduct audits to maintain transparency and accountability.

Animal Welfare

When it comes to animal welfare, Olmsted Outerwear has a ‘good’ rating. They do not use fur, wool, exotic animal skin, exotic animal hair, or angora in their products. Instead, they opt for ethically sourced down and use leather. Although the use of leather may raise some concerns among animal welfare advocates, Olmsted Outerwear’s commitment to not using other animal-derived materials demonstrates a conscious effort to reduce their impact on animals.
